This role involves innovating and delivering solutions that support a studio whose content is legendary and transcends generations. You will be part of a team that provides cutting-edge filmmaking systems in the public cloud, focused on automation and infrastructure-as-code for all studios under the Disney umbrella.
- Build and operate high-quality production systems
- Design systems to enable rapid development, high availability, and clear observability
- Maintain and improve the reliability of services and infrastructure
- Troubleshoot and resolve performance and reliability issues across the stack, including cloud resources
- Collaborate with engineers to ensure services are designed to be cloud-native, scalable, and easily operated
- Create self-healing infrastructure-as-Code and automate everything
- Ensure security best practices are at the forefront of all technical solutions
Qualifications:
- Strong written and verbal communication skills
- Comfortable working with public cloud service providers (e.g. AWS, Google, Azure)
- Strong knowledge in system management languages (e.g. Terraform, Ansible)
- Operating systems and systems management (e.g. Amazon Linux, Windows)
- Multiple scripting languages in your toolbox (e.g. Python, GO, Ruby, or Swift)
- Experience working with observability tools for optimal performance and 24/7 reliability (e.g. DataDog, New Relic, Grafana)
- Data center, network, and application architectures
- Systems Security (e.g. key management, encryption, vulnerability management)
- Containerization and Container PaaS offerings (e.g. Docker, Rancher, Kubernetes)
- Thorough knowledge of continuous integration tools (e.g. Jenkins, GitLab CI/CD)
- BS in Computer Science or related field with 5+ years of experience or equivalent
Requirements:
- Experience working in media production environments
- Passionate to explore new technologies and constantly learn
- Exceptional analytical and problem-solving skills
